Amazon Web Services
Discover and interact with AWS (Amazon Web Services) resources.
The AWS molecule enables discovery of AWS cloud infrastructure including EC2 instances, S3 buckets, Lambda functions, RDS databases, and more. It provides comprehensive visibility into your AWS environment.
- Discovery: Automatically discover AWS resources across your account
- MCP Tools: Interact with AWS services via MCP protocol
- Multi-Region: Support for discovering resources across multiple AWS regions
discovery:
enabled: true
settings:
access_key_id: "your-access-key"
secret_access_key: "your-secret-key"
region: "us-east-1"
mcp:
enabled: true
settings:
access_key_id: "your-access-key"
secret_access_key: "your-secret-key"
region: "us-east-1"
aws.sixdegree.ai/v1/EC2Instance- EC2 virtual machinesaws.sixdegree.ai/v1/S3Bucket- S3 storage bucketsaws.sixdegree.ai/v1/LambdaFunction- Lambda serverless functionsaws.sixdegree.ai/v1/RDSDatabase- RDS databases
The AWS molecule requires AWS credentials with appropriate permissions to list and describe resources. You can provide credentials via:
- Access Key ID and Secret Access Key
- IAM role (when running on EC2)
- AWS credential file
Required IAM permissions:
-
ec2:DescribeInstances -
s3:ListBuckets -
lambda:ListFunctions -
rds:DescribeDBInstances